Enrolled: Tevon Coney

Palm Beach Gardens (Fla.) High linebacker Tevon Coney enrolled on Jan. 11 for the spring semester.
The 6-1, 221-pounder is ranked as a four-star recruit, the No. 20 player in Florida, the No. 6 inside linebacker in the nation and the No. 118 overall prospect in the country by Rivals.

Measurables
• Benches 335 pounds and squats 550 pounds.
Statistics
• Totaled 136 tackles, 12 sacks, two fumble recoveries and two interceptions during his senior season.
• Led Palm Beach Gardens to the Class 8A state semifinals as a junior while posting a team-high 172 tackles, plus 14 sacks, six forced fumbles and two interceptions.
Honors
• Named to the Associated Press Class 8A second-team all-state defense as a senior and junior.
• Tabbed as a Sun Sentinel "Super 11" selection and a first-team all-area pick on defense as a senior.
• Listed as a first-team all-area selection on defense in 2014 and a second-team pick in 2013 by The Palm Beach Post.
• Recognized by ESPN 106.3 as the No. 2 player in the "Top 63" seniors in the Palm Beach and Treasure Coast area.
• Was a late addition to the Under Armour All-American Game Jan. 2 in St. Petersburg, Fla., but proved to be one of the top linebackers on hand after finishing with four tackles for Team Armour in a 46-6 loss.
• Participated in The Opening at the Nike headquarters in Beaverton, Ore., last summer.
• Named Most Valuable Linebacker of the Miami Nike Football Training Camp on March 16, 2014.
Recruitment
• Committed to Notre Dame on Oct. 23, 2014, over Miami and Florida. The Irish were able to fend off late pushes from both the Canes and Gators, who tried to flip Coney in the eleventh hour.
• Was courted by recruiting coordinator Tony Alford, who identified him early in the process and was able to get him on campus for an unofficial visit over the summer.
• Camped in South Bend in June and was back for an official visit for the Michigan game the weekend of Sept. 6, 2014.
• Took multiple trips to both Miami and Florida during the recruiting process, along with unofficial visits to Auburn and Tennessee.
Notable
• Born on June 10, 1994.
• High school head coach Rob Freeman's father is good friends with Notre Dame assistant Bob Elliott.
2015 Projection
• Expected to compete for playing time at linebacker and contribute on special teams.
They Said It
Rivals Southeast recruiting analyst Woody Wommack: "He is an ideal middle linebacker. He is a little bit undersized but moves very well in space and is really aggressive to the ball.
"He sort of came out of nowhere initially, and we weren't sure if he was just a camp- or offseason-type guy, but he had a great senior season. He came down to the Under Armour game and really impressed us with his play going against the best of the best. He looked like a big-time player.
"His stock is on the rise, and he keeps getting better and better. I think that is a great get for Notre Dame - to go down into South Florida and get a kid like that."
Prep Football Report's Tom Lemming: "He's not a real tall guy, but he fits well for them at inside linebacker. He makes plays and was All-Palm Beach County, and that's a very good area for top talent."
